Epitome

Epitome (noun) refers to a person or thing that is a perfect example of a particular quality or type; it signifies the embodiment of characteristics and traits that represent a larger category. The term can also indicate a summary or condensed version of a written work, encapsulating its main ideas in a brief form. As a literary device, it emphasizes the quintessential nature of someone or something.
